Natural Landscape
In addition to its rich history, Tshikapa is also known for its stunning natural landscape. The city is situated at the confluence of the Kasai and Tshikapa rivers, making it an ideal place for outdoor activities such as fishing and canoeing. The surroundings of Tshikapa also offer opportunities for hiking and bird watching, with a wide variety of native species to see.

Diamond Mining
Tshikapa is also known for its diamond mining industry. Visitors can learn more about this important industry at the Tshikapa Mining Museum, which offers exhibits on the history of diamond mining in the region and the importance of this industry to the local economy.

Gastronomic Products of Tshikapa
-
Makayabu
Makayabu is a popular dish in Tshikapa and throughout the Democratic Republic of the Congo. It is a sun-dried and salted fish that is used in a variety of dishes. It is often cooked with onion, garlic, pepper, tomato, and palm oil, and served with fufu, a staple food made from cassava.
-
Chikwangue
Chikwangue, also known as "cassava bread", is another important gastronomic product in Tshikapa. It is a staple food made from fermented cassava and wrapped in banana leaves. It has a dense and gummy texture and a slightly sour taste. It can be eaten alone or with sauces and stews.
-
Liboké
Liboké is a traditional cooking method in Tshikapa and throughout the Democratic Republic of the Congo. Food is wrapped in banana leaves and then steamed or roasted. This method is used to cook a variety of foods, including fish, meat, and vegetables, and gives the food a unique and delicious flavor.
